CroppedBitmap Konstruktory
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Inicjuje nowe wystąpienie klasy CroppedBitmap.
Przeciążenia
CroppedBitmap() |
Inicjuje nowe wystąpienie klasy CroppedBitmap. |
CroppedBitmap(BitmapSource, Int32Rect) |
Inicjuje CroppedBitmap nowe wystąpienie klasy z określonymi Source parametrami i SourceRect. |
CroppedBitmap()
Inicjuje nowe wystąpienie klasy CroppedBitmap.
public:
CroppedBitmap();
public CroppedBitmap ();
Public Sub New ()
Uwagi
CroppedBitmap Implementuje interfejs w ISupportInitialize celu optymalizacji inicjowania na wielu właściwościach. Aby zainicjować utworzony przy użyciu tego konstruktora CroppedBitmap , należy wykonać inicjowanie właściwości między wywołaniami BeginInit i EndInit .
Dotyczy
CroppedBitmap(BitmapSource, Int32Rect)
Inicjuje CroppedBitmap nowe wystąpienie klasy z określonymi Source parametrami i SourceRect.
public:
CroppedBitmap(System::Windows::Media::Imaging::BitmapSource ^ source, System::Windows::Int32Rect sourceRect);
public CroppedBitmap (System.Windows.Media.Imaging.BitmapSource source, System.Windows.Int32Rect sourceRect);
new System.Windows.Media.Imaging.CroppedBitmap : System.Windows.Media.Imaging.BitmapSource * System.Windows.Int32Rect -> System.Windows.Media.Imaging.CroppedBitmap
Public Sub New (source As BitmapSource, sourceRect As Int32Rect)
Parametry
- source
- BitmapSource
Element Source nowego CroppedBitmap wystąpienia.
- sourceRect
- Int32Rect
Element SourceRect nowego CroppedBitmap wystąpienia.
Wyjątki
source
to null
.
sourceRect
znajduje się poza granicami .source
Przykłady
W poniższym przykładzie pokazano, jak zainicjować CroppedBitmap(BitmapSource, Int32Rect) CroppedBitmap nowe wystąpienie klasy.
// Create an Image element.
Image chainImage = new Image();
chainImage.Width = 200;
chainImage.Margin = new Thickness(5);
// Create the cropped image based on previous CroppedBitmap.
CroppedBitmap chained = new CroppedBitmap(cb,
new Int32Rect(30, 0, (int)cb.Width-30, (int)cb.Height));
// Set the image's source.
chainImage.Source = chained;
' Create an Image element.
Dim chainImage As New Image()
chainImage.Width = 200
chainImage.Margin = New Thickness(5)
' Create the cropped image based on previous CroppedBitmap.
Dim chained As New CroppedBitmap(cb, New Int32Rect(30, 0, CType(cb.Width, Integer) - 30, CType(cb.Height, Integer)))
' Set the image's source.
chainImage.Source = chained
Uwagi
CroppedBitmap obiekty utworzone przy użyciu tego konstruktora są automatycznie inicjowane. Po zainicjowaniu zmiany właściwości są ignorowane.